2016 notwithstanding, Leroux has been making this wine from the same 0.35 hectares of vines since 2002 (pre-2007, this was at Comte Armand). This is from three parcels in Vireuils Dessus—one of the higher sites of Meursault—sitting above the renowned Les Chevalières and Rougeots lieux-dits in one of the best parts of Meursault for villages level. Vireuils is an east-facing, late-ripening site, with pure, rocky, limestone and flint soils. The vines are now around 45 years of age and, as always, have gifted a wine of intense minerality. It’s a vineyard that performs exceptionally in warm and generous years like 2018, with the wine’s sappy, high-grown freshness providing mouth-watering tension.
White peach, hazelnut, a little peppermint white chocolate, pretty floral notes. It’s silky and fine, flows along smoothly, a fine chalk dust texture, a subtle green herb and lemon zest bitterness cinching the finish. Dusting of white pepper as it goes. It’s a lovely thing to drink. All just so. - Gary Walsh, Winefront
